Chawalde - Sindkhede, Dhule

Chawalde is a village situated in the Sindkhede tehsil of Dhule district, Maharashtra. It is located approximately 40 km from the tehsil headquarters in Sindkhede and around 77 km from the district headquarters in Dhule. Tavkheda P.n. serves as the Gram Panchayat for Chawalde village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Chawalde is 526099. The village covers a total geographical area of 366.28 hectares and falls under the 425408 pincode. Dondaicha is the nearest town, located about 18 km away.

Chawalde village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Chawalde

As per Census 2011, Chawalde village has a total population of 226 people, consisting of 120 males and 106 females. The village has 42 households and a sex ratio of 883 females per 1,000 males. There are 33 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 70 literate and 156 illiterate residents. Additionally, 202 people belong to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Chawalde

Chawalde is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Dondaicha, while the nearest airport is Jalgaon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 96.2 km.
